Improve Motor Efficiency with Soft Starter

Soft starters are specifically designed to protect and enhance the performance of electric motors by controlling the way they start. Unlike traditional direct-on-line (DOL) starter, which immediately apply full voltage to the motor, soft starter gradually ramp up the voltage and current. This controlled increase in power allows for a smoother start, significantly reducing the mechanical and electrical stresses that can occur during the motor’s startup phase. By minimizing these stresses, soft starter not only safeguard the motor from potential damage but also help extend its operational lifespan. Additionally, by reducing the impact on other system components, soft starter contribute to the overall reliability and longevity of the entire system.

Key Benefits of Soft Starter

Smooth Start Up for Power Distribution Systems

: When you start a motor with a soft starter, it gradually increases the voltage, preventing the power surge that typically occurs with traditional starters. By gradually ramping up the current and controlling the voltage, it reduces the inrush current, ensuring a smooth motor startup. This controlled approach not only avoids the sudden spikes in current seen with DOL and Star-Delta starters but also reduces the risk of voltage sags and system instability, providing a much smoother and more stable operation.

 

Mechanical Stress Reduction in Motor Starters

: The controlled ramp-up avoids sudden jerks and shocks that can cause wear and tear on the motor and connected machinery, such as bearings and gears. This can significantly lower maintenance costs and downtime.

Applications of Soft Starters

Soft starters are a great choice for any motor-driven system where you need a controlled start and stop. They are particularly useful in industries where protecting equipment and ensuring smooth operation is crucial. Some common applications include:

Conveyor Systems

: Soft starter prevent sudden jolts that could disrupt production lines, ensuring smoother starts and stops.

Pumps & Fans

: These systems benefit from soft starters by preventing sudden pressure changes that could damage pipes, valves, or the motor itself.

Compressors

: Soft starter ensure a gradual ramp-up, preventing shock loads that could damage the compressor and other components.

HVAC Systems

: Soft starter are also used in heating, ventilation, and air conditioning systems, where controlled startup and smooth operation are critical.

Customization and Features

Soft starters come in different configurations to suit specific motor sizes and application needs. They typically feature microprocessor-based control, allowing for precise control over:

Acceleration and Deceleration

: Soft starters let you set the motor’s ramp-up and ramp-down speeds to match the requirements of your system.

Overload Protection

: Built-in features protect the motor from overheating and overcurrent situations.

Adaptability

: Some soft starters can adjust to varying load conditions, making them more flexible and efficient for different applications.
